This book on hollow fiber contractors presents an up-to-date compilation of the latest developments and milestones in this membrane technology. Hollow Fiber Membrane Contactors: Module Fabrication, Design and Operation, and Potential Applications provides a comprehensive discussion of hollow fiber membrane applications (including a few case studies) in biotechnology, chemical, food, and nuclear engineering.

The chapters in this book have been classified using the following, based on different ways of contacting fluids with each other: Gas-liquid contacting; Liquid-liquid contacting; Supported liquid membrane; Supported gas membrane; Fluid-fluid contacting.

Other features include:

Discusses using non-dispersive solvent extraction, hollow fiber strip dispersion, hollow fiber supported liquid membranes and role of process intensification in integrated use of these processes

Provides technical and economic perspectives with several case studies related to specific scenarios

Demonstrates module fabrication, design, operation and maintenance of hollow fiber contactors for different applications and performance

Presents discussion on newer concepts like membrane emulsification, membrane nanoprecipitation, membrane crystallization and membrane condenser

Special focus on emerging areas such as the use of hollow fiber contactor in back end of nuclear fuel cycle, membrane distillation, dehumidification of air and gas absorption and stripping

Discusses theoretical analysis including computational modeling of different hollow fiber membrane processes, and presents emphasis on newly developed area of hollow fiber membrane based analytical techniques

Presents discussion on upcoming area dealing with hollow fiber contactors-based technology in fermentation and enzymatic transformation and in chiral separations

This book is equally suited for newcomers to the field, as well as for engineers and scientists that have basic knowledge in this field but are interested in obtaining more information about specific future applications.
